May 26: 7pm. Lessons for Vegetarians and Vegans from the EPIC-Oxford study. EPIC-Oxford is a long-term study of the health of 65,000 Britons, including more than 20,000 vegetarians and vegans. Paul Appleby of the Cancer Research UK Epidemiology Unit reviews the main findings to date. Plus buffet supper. Members £4, non-members £5, less £2 for concessions.
